Why Charter Oak’s Climate & Housing Affect Gate Repair
Charter Oak sits pressed against the San Gabriel Mountains, directly in the path of Santa Ana wind events that channel down through the foothills with more force than communities further west in the valley experience. These sustained gusts - often 40 to 60 mph during peak events - create cyclical loading on swing-gate hinges and cantilevered slide-gate systems that flatland gate designers don’t account for. We see post lean, hinge shear, and track displacement here at measurably higher rates than in Covina or West Covina. The same dry, hot winds strip protective coatings from wrought iron and accelerate oxidation, compressing maintenance cycles from every seven years to every four or five.
The housing stock compounds this. Charter Oak built out heavily in the 1950s through 1970s as ranch-style single-family homes on generously sized lots - larger than inner-valley Covina - with long driveways and side-yard access points that owners have historically fenced and gated. Those original ornamental wrought-iron and tubular-steel gates are now fifty to seventy years old. The hinges haven’t been lubricated since the Reagan era. The posts are set in concrete that has cracked with decades of thermal cycling. When we open these systems for repair, we often find hardware that hasn’t been available since the 1980s, which means custom fabrication or careful retrofitting - not a parts-swap any handyman can manage.
And because Charter Oak is an unincorporated LA County community, not an incorporated city, permit work for automatic gate operators routes through the LA County Department of Public Works and Building & Safety rather than a municipal building department. Many San Gabriel Valley gate companies maintain portal accounts only for Covina, Glendora, or West Covina and aren’t equipped to navigate the county’s Permit & Inspection Request system without delays that cost homeowners weeks. We’ve handled LA County permits since 1984. The correct paperwork gets filed the first time.
Pricing for Gate Repair in Charter Oak
We settle on an upfront price before turning a single bolt. No surprises on the bill.
| Service |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Hinge adjustment or lubrication | $180 - $260 |
| Single hinge replacement (weld-on) | $240 - $380 |
| Gate motor / opener repair | $280 - $520 |
| Gate motor replacement (installed) | $680 - $1,400 |
| Track realignment or section replacement | $320 - $650 |
| Access control keypad or remote programming | $150 - $340 |
| Seasonal tune-up (inspection, lube, adjustment) | $89 |

Santa Ana winds channeling through the foothills create lateral stress that flatland gates never see, and Charter Oak’s 1950s-1970s housing stock often has original posts set in concrete that has cracked over decades. Combined with hinge corrosion from dry, hot wind exposure, the geometry of your gate shifts until it drags or binds. We assess post integrity, hinge condition, and frame squareness - then fix the root cause, not just the symptom.
Because Charter Oak is unincorporated LA County, automatic gate operator permits route through the LA County Department of Public Works and Building & Safety - not a city building department. Many local companies only maintain portal accounts for incorporated cities like Covina or Glendora and can’t file county permits efficiently. We’ve handled LA County permits since 1984; the correct paperwork gets submitted without delay.
For Charter Oak’s older ornamental iron gates, repair is usually the better value - the metal itself often outlasts three generations of hardware, and custom fabrication preserves the original character that modern prefab gates can’t replicate.
